Description

A group of six unidentified members of the 1st Battalion, The Royal Australian Regiment (1RAR) rest in a clearing at a camp in at Nui Dat. Uniforms, towels and blankets have been draped over trees and sticks to dry. On the left is a hoochie (temporary canvas shelter), while on the ground in front of the men is a water container, a bag of coloured boxes (possibly cigarettes), and a machete speared into the ground.
